Orlando Bloom admits he was not a joy to be around on the sets of The Cut.
The actor admittedly told Yahoo in a recent interview that he was grumpy duirng the shooting of the movie and was confined to a room as he trained for his character, He later recalled feeling physical deprivation from tough boxing schedules.
“I didn’t feel very good — angry and hungry,” he confessed.
“We are built for sleep, food and water,” said Bloom. “When you take all three of those away — because you don't really sleep when you're that hungry...I was sleeping a few hours a night. I literally had no mental or physical capacity. I was lying on the floor between takes and then getting up to work.”
“I was really restricting the water, and all of that made it just way harder than I had imagined,” he explained.
“Water restriction to get to my lowest weight for the final scenes led to obsessive thoughts of food,” he shared, “dreaming of what I could eat when finally off a diet of tuna and cucumber.”
